MIRI: Wushu exponents from the Sarawak Miri Wushu Association and Sarawak Lambir Chin Woo Athletic Association had a fruitful outing at the Malaysian National Chin Woo Wushu Championship in Kuala Lumpur recently.

The 11-member team captured a total of three gold, seven silver and 11 bronze medals in the national championship.

Phang Yii Fei won two gold medals from the men’s daoshu and gunshu events in Group A while Phang Yii Gin won the gold medal in Group B men’s daoshu.

Three exponents Phang Yii Gin, John Yu Zi Xiang and Gloria Tipung Samual contributed two silver medals each in their respective events.

Phang won the silvers in Group B men’s changquan and men’s gunshu while John Yu was second in Group A men’s nandao and nangun.

Gloria’s silvers came from the Group B women’s changquan and qiangshu and Chai Min Lin won the silver in Group B women’s qiangshu.

The bronze medalists were Phang Yii Fei (Group A men’s changquan), John Yu Zi Xiang (Group A men’s nanquan), Tiong Ying Shing (Group A men’s nandao, nangun), Chai Min Li (Group B women’s changquan), Gloria Tipung (Group B women’s nandao), Kelvin Lau Luen Hou (Group B men’s 42 taijiquan), Andy Yap Liang Xin (Group B men’s nanquan), Silas Leong (Group B men’s jianshu), Arthur Lau Hui Siag (Group B men’s jianshu) and Hii Wei Sheng (Group B men’s nandao).
